Match Overview

The match took place at Blundell Park, Grimsby, on October 14, 2023, where Grimsby Town welcomed Swindon Town in front of a lively home crowd. From the outset, it was evident that both teams were keen to assert their dominance on the pitch. Grimsby Town, known for their resilient defending and passionate home support, faced Swindon, a team with a reputation for attacking prowess.

Key Events

The first half saw Grimsby Town controlling much of the possession but struggling to create clear-cut chances. Swindon Town’s counter-attacking strategy paid dividends when, in the 30th minute, striker Harry McKirdy found the net, putting Swindon 1-0 up. The visitors’ goal boosted their confidence, and they began to press Grimsby into making mistakes.

In the second half, Grimsby Town rallied, demonstrating their tenacity. With tactical changes made by manager Paul Hurst, they managed to equalise in the 62nd minute through a superb header from defender Luke Waterfall from a corner kick. This goal reignited hopes for the home side, leading to a surge in momentum.

The final stages of the match saw both teams creating opportunities but failing to convert them into goals. Swindon Town’s goalkeeper, Lewis Ward, made several critical saves, while Grimsby’s keeper, Max Crocombe, also thwarted attempts to prevent a late winner from Swindon.

Conclusion

The match concluded in a 1-1 draw, leaving both teams with one point. This result is significant as Grimsby Town continues to build on their recent performances, while Swindon Town aims to maintain their position in the promotion race.
